Bathong! The drama surrounding MacG had taken a dramatic twist. A South African influencer claims that they were offered thousands of Rands to lead a smear campaign against the popular podcaster.
Podcast and Chill head honcho MacG has long claimed that a powerful group of South African celebrities is plotting his downfall. He even claimed that a prominent businessman had funded coordinated attacks against him after his comments about Minnie Dlamini.
While some dismissed MacG’s comments as paranoia or clout-chasing, a prominent South African influencer’s revelation gives the podcaster's claims credibility.
Prominent influencer exposes R100K offer to attack MacG online
Fresh from leading a highly publicised fundraising campaign for General Nhlanhla Mkhwanazi, controversial influencer Chris Excel dropped a bombshell. On Monday, 25 August 2025, Chris Excel shared that he had been approached with a mouthwatering offer to attack MacG.

In the post, Chris Excel shared how someone approached him with a vague business offer. The message read:
“Hi, Chris. If you don't mind, we won't reveal our details yet. But another lady friend of ours told us that you're the right person for this job. Please let me know when you're free to talk.”

After Chris Excel gave the person the green light, the unnamed individual offered him R100,000 to lead a smear campaign against MacG. Alternatively, the individual suggested that Chris Excel call out Mzansi Magic for allowing MacG to feature on Shaka iLembe.
The message read:
“Thanks. We're not sure what your stance is on MacGyver Mukwevho, but since it's business, we'd like to offer you R100k to find any dirt or drag Mzansi Magic for featuring MacGyver in last night's episode. Please note that we'll pay R20K upfront once we've reached the agreement. If you're interested, please advise so that we can give you Namhla's email address, where you'll email us your terms and banking details. She will send you our terms and further clarity. Thank you.”
Chris Excel rejected the offer.
